简介
Anchovy (Coilia mystus) protein hydrolysate (APH) and its Maillard reaction product (APH-M) with d-ribose were subjected to in vivo mouse behavioral trials and associated with biochemical analyses, in vitro H2O2-stressed PC12 cell assay and inhibition of acetylcholin esterase (AchE) to explore the mechanism of the behavioral trial findings. Results revealed that both APH and APH-M could alleviate undesired alterations on hippocampus ultrastructure of mice, protect PC12 from H2O2-induced oxidative stress, and inhibit AchE activity in vivo and in vitro, suggesting the well-being potential for combating memory-impairment in mice. Moreover, APH-M exhibited much stronger abilities above than APH. The test of acetylcholinergic system indicated that APH-M would improve memory mainly through regulating the AchE activity, while APH through controlling the mRNA expression of ChAT and AchE activity.
